-/*!
- \file http.h
- \brief Support for Private Asterisk HTTP Servers.
- \note Note: The Asterisk HTTP servers are extremely simple and minimal and
- only support the "GET" method.
- \author Mark Spencer <markster@digium.com>
-*/
-
-/*! \brief HTTP Callbacks take the socket, the method and the path as arguments and should
- return the content, allocated with malloc(). Status should be changed to reflect
- the status of the request if it isn't 200 and title may be set to a malloc()'d string
- to an appropriate title for non-200 responses. Content length may also be specified.
- The return value may include additional headers at the front and MUST include a blank
- line with \r\n to provide separation between user headers and content (even if no
- content is specified) */
-typedef char *(*ast_http_callback)(struct sockaddr_in *requestor, const char *uri, struct ast_variable *params, int *status, char **title, int *contentlength);
-
-struct ast_http_uri {
- struct ast_http_uri *next;
- const char *description;
- const char *uri;
- unsigned int has_subtree:1;
- /*! This URI mapping serves static content */
- unsigned int static_content:1;
- ast_http_callback callback;
-};
-
-/*! \brief Link into the Asterisk HTTP server */
-int ast_http_uri_link(struct ast_http_uri *urihandler);
-
-/*! \brief Return a malloc()'d string containing an HTTP error message */
-char *ast_http_error(int status, const char *title, const char *extra_header, const char *text);
-
-/*! \brief Destroy an HTTP server */
-void ast_http_uri_unlink(struct ast_http_uri *urihandler);
-
-char *ast_http_setcookie(const char *var, const char *val, int expires, char *buf, size_t buflen);
-
-int ast_http_init(void);
-int ast_http_reload(void);
-
-#endif /* _ASTERISK_SRV_H */
